Comment JavaScript obtient-il des effets dynamiques sur les pages Web ?
JavaScript est un langage de développement frontal qui peut rendre les pages Web plus vivantes et interactives. Grâce à JavaScript, les développeurs peuvent implémenter des effets dynamiques sur les pages Web, tels que des animations, des réponses aux événements, etc. Ce qui suit présente quelques techniques JavaScript courantes pour vous aider à obtenir des effets dynamiques sur les pages Web.
Changer le style des éléments
Vous pouvez modifier le style des éléments de la page Web via JavaScript, par exemple en changeant la couleur, la taille, la position, etc. Voici un exemple, lorsque la souris survole un bouton, la couleur du bouton passe au rouge :
document.getElementById('btn').onmouseover = function() { this.style.color = 'red'; };
Effets d'animation
En utilisant JavaScript, vous pouvez créer divers effets d'animation, tels que fondu entrant et sortant, glisser, faire pivoter. , etc. Voici un exemple d'effet de fondu simple :
function fadeIn(element) { let opacity = 0; const interval = setInterval(function() { if (opacity < 1) { opacity += 0.1; element.style.opacity = opacity; } else { clearInterval(interval); } }, 100); } fadeIn(document.getElementById('element'));
Réponse aux événements utilisateur
JavaScript peut répondre aux événements d'interaction de l'utilisateur, tels que les clics de souris, les saisies au clavier, etc. Ce qui suit est un exemple simple de réponse à un événement. Lorsque l'utilisateur clique sur le bouton, des informations sont affichées sur la console :
document.getElementById('btn').onclick = function() { console.log('按钮被点击了!') };
Chargement dynamique du contenu
Parfois, il est nécessaire de charger dynamiquement du contenu Web, comme le chargement asynchrone de données ou partie de la page. Voici un exemple d'utilisation de JavaScript pour charger dynamiquement du contenu. Lorsque vous cliquez sur le bouton, un nouveau paragraphe est chargé sur la page :
document.getElementById('btn').onclick = function() { const newParagraph = document.createElement('p'); newParagraph.innerHTML = '这是一个新的段落'; document.getElementById('content').appendChild(newParagraph); };
Voici quelques exemples d'utilisation de JavaScript pour obtenir des effets dynamiques sur des pages Web. j'espère que cela pourra vous apporter un peu d'inspiration. JavaScript est un outil puissant qui peut aider les développeurs à créer des expériences Web plus riches et plus vivantes.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!